Winter fake-outs: Skating and snow in SoCal and beyond
Southern California can be so fake in winter. Snow does fall in the local mountains, but Long Beach and Carlsbad? Hardly. It's all part of a need to conjure picturesque holiday scenes despite balmy temperatures. So if you really need to get your (fake) winter on, here are some places to try. And really, you won't need to bundle up at all.

The Cosmopolitan of Las Vegas( Denise Truscello )
The Cosmopolitan is going for the Central Park feel on the Las Vegas Strip. This is the hotel's first pool-to-ice-skating-rink trick. It costs $15 to skate and $5 to rent skates at the rink, which will remain until Jan. 20. And there are fire pits and s'mores to be had here too.
